Two Crow Wing County road construction projects are scheduled to begin next month.

The county entered into a contract with Redstone Construction for the replacement of the deck on the bridge crossing the Nokasippi River, about 8 miles south of Brainerd.

The project will consist of providing a new bridge deck, railing, guardrail and associated items. County Highway 45 at the project location is scheduled to be closed to traffic beginning May 2. Traffic will be detoured utilizing County Road 131, and county highways 21 and 2.

The county also entered into a contract with DeChantal Excavating for the construction of a roundabout at County Highway 49 (Wise Road) and County Highway 5 (Beaver Dam Road) north of Brainerd.

The project will consist of grading, storm sewer, concrete curb and gutter, bituminous surfacing and associated signing and lighting, and is also scheduled to begin May 2, at which time traffic on Wise Road will be detoured. The detour will utilize highways 371 and 210 and Mill Avenue. Users of Beaver Dam Road will need to use Riverside Drive to access the detour route.

The county will post updates on social media, and the highway department website at crowwing.us/149/Current-Projects .

County Highway 45 and Wise Road are anticipated to be open to traffic in July of 2022. Final paving operations may take place after this date. Visit the county’s website or call the highway department at 218-824-1110 for additional information on the projects.
